
Public Forum on Heroin and Opioid Addiction Set at NU
Robert G. Ortt
Co-Chairman of the Senate Task Force on Heroin and Opioid Addiction Sen. Rob Ortt has announced one of the several open forums will take place at Niagara University on May 7. There, he and a panel of speakers will hear gather ideas from the public in order to strengthen legislation on the growing problem. Read more about the forum from The Buffalo News.
